Nick Cannon is an entertainer, producer and television personality who got his start on Nickelodeon. As a teenager he was a regular on Nickelodeon's improv show All That and the host of The Nick Cannon Show. He made his film debut with a leading role in the 2002 high school drama Drumline, while simultaneously recording his self-titled debut album that was released in 2003. Cannon starred in a series of movies throughout the early 2000s, including the 2003 comedy Love Don't Cost a Thing, and secured a sketch comedy show, Wild n' Out, on MTV that ran from 2005 to 2007. His work in both the entertainment and music businesses has steadily kept him in lucrative positions in pop culture: he became the host of America's Got Talent during the show's fourth season and continues to work as the Chairman of TeenNick. Following a high-profile relationship and marriage with singer Mariah Carey in 2008, Cannon's career only progressed further. He started hosting a morning radio show on NOW FM, formed his own label N'Credible Entertainment, and embarked on a comedy tour all in the year 2010.
